首页 >> 日常问答 >

开机后出现多个svchost进程

2025-10-26 23:45:01

问题描述:

开机后出现多个svchost进程,跪求好心人,别让我卡在这里!

最佳答案

推荐答案

2025-10-26 23:45:01

开机后出现多个svchost进程】在Windows系统中,`svchost.exe` 是一个核心系统进程,用于托管多个Windows服务。正常情况下,系统会根据需要启动多个 `svchost.exe` 进程来运行不同的服务组,这是系统正常运行的一部分。然而,当用户发现开机后出现了大量 `svchost.exe` 进程时,可能会感到疑惑甚至担忧,担心是否存在恶意软件或系统异常。

以下是对“开机后出现多个svchost进程”这一现象的总结与分析:

一、什么是 svchost.exe?

`svchost.exe` 是 Windows 操作系统中的一个系统进程,负责运行多个 Windows 服务。这些服务可以是系统级的(如网络服务、安全服务)或第三方应用程序的服务。为了提高效率和资源管理,Windows 将不同功能的服务分配到不同的 `svchost.exe` 进程中运行。

二、为什么开机后会出现多个 svchost.exe 进程?

1. 系统服务分组

Windows 将相似的服务归为一组,每个组由一个独立的 `svchost.exe` 实例运行。例如,网络相关服务可能在一个 `svchost` 进程中运行,而系统管理服务可能在另一个进程中运行。

2. 多核 CPU 支持

在多核处理器环境下,系统可能会为不同的服务组分配不同的 `svchost.exe` 进程,以提高性能和稳定性。

3. 第三方程序影响

一些第三方软件(如杀毒软件、驱动程序等)也可能注册自己的服务,并由 `svchost.exe` 承载。

4. 恶意软件伪装

有些恶意软件会伪装成 `svchost.exe`,并以多个实例运行,从而隐藏自身行为。这种情况下,需特别注意。

三、如何判断是否为正常现象?

判断项 正常情况 异常情况
进程数量 通常为 3-5 个 超过 10 个以上
进程来源 系统文件(路径为 C:\Windows\System32\svchost.exe) 非系统路径(如临时文件夹、下载目录等)
CPU/内存占用 合理范围 明显过高或持续飙升
是否有可疑服务 有未知服务或异常名称
使用工具检查 任务管理器、Process Explorer 第三方安全工具(如 Malwarebytes、火绒)

四、建议操作步骤

1. 使用任务管理器查看进程信息

- 查看每个 `svchost.exe` 的“命令行”参数,确认其所属的服务组。

- 检查是否有非系统路径的 `svchost.exe`。

2. 使用 Process Explorer 工具

- 可查看更详细的进程信息,包括加载的 DLL 文件和调用的服务。

3. 运行杀毒软件扫描

- 使用主流杀毒软件(如 Windows Defender、360 安全卫士、火绒等)进行全盘扫描。

4. 检查系统日志

- 通过“事件查看器”查看系统日志,寻找异常服务启动记录。

5. 考虑重装系统

- 如果怀疑系统被入侵,且无法确认原因,可考虑备份数据后重装系统。

五、总结

开机后出现多个 `svchost.exe` 进程并不一定意味着系统存在问题,但也不能完全忽视。合理判断其来源、占用情况以及是否为系统默认行为,是确保系统安全的关键。如果存在疑虑,建议结合多种工具进行排查,必要时寻求专业支持。

注: 本文内容基于实际系统运维经验撰写,旨在帮助用户理解系统行为,降低对系统进程的误判风险。

  免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。

 
分享:
最新文章